Economic crisis era guide shows how money value shifts ripple through rail costs and prices. This work examines how the dollar’s purchasing power has changed since 1897 and what that means for railway rates, costs, and public policy. It presents a critical look at the link between currency value, inflation, and transport economics.
This edition gathers expert opinions and data-driven discussion to explore why railway schedules may need revision and how monetary depreciation affects business and public welfare. It uses historical context to explain why prices and wages rise even as nominal rail rates appear steady, and what policy moves could stabilize essential services.
